Contrast

#407ef2 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
3.83: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#286ef0 as the text (4.59:1)
  • AAA: use #0e4fc8 as the text (7.07: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#1a1a1a (4.55:1)
Aaon black
5.48: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#6295f4 as the text (7.12: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#407ef2 as the background.
